A dilation centered at the origin is applied to the line y = 3x + 5. What is true about the image of the line?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 01-08-2018

If a dilation centered at the origin is applied to the line y = 3x + 5, then the resulting dilation will produce an image of the same slope as the original line but of different y-intercept. If the dilation is greater than 1, the image will move further away from the origin. If the dilation is less than 1, the opposite will be true.
